Output 61f8bb0a30c8e9207c260965e27639996064878d852a9e7ae01c2f8ce0359092:0

value
1284184
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c10f83d71e0f8a7bce635f6f65104c155b21816a OP_EQUAL
address
3KHpvZuhNWifdrMrg3ML1usGL514gy2Vcq
transaction
61f8bb0a30c8e9207c260965e27639996064878d852a9e7ae01c2f8ce0359092
spent
true